The Latent Heterosexual is a play by Paddy Chayefsky.[1] The author would not permit it to be performed on Broadway,[2] but it opened at the Dallas Theater Center in March 1968,[1] directed by Burgess Meredith, with a cast that included Zero Mostel and Jules Munshin.[3]
